Not dated but likely c 1950. [2] 32, 814 [2] 248, 64 [8] Soft leather binding, with gild masonic emblem on front, zip sealed with elegant masonic catch in brass and blue enamel (?). Linen enriched endpapers. All edges gilt. Colour plate frontispiece and further colour and monochrome plate illustrations, eight colour maps at end. (Covers gently rubbed at spine joints and tips; internally neat, clean and fresh. A beautifully inscribed dedication - to Harry Lumpton - fills the presentation page while opposite and touching dedicated from his daughter presenting this bible, after Harry's passing to 'the best possible guardian', gifted as a 'celebration of the friendship you shared'. Several signatures on the Visiting Brethen pages). King James's Authorised Version of the Old and New Testaments, preceded by an essay by H L Haywood on Freemasonry and the Bible, and followed by references of especial interest to Freemasons and aids to Bible Study.
